A former presidential candidate, Dr. Gbenga Olawepo-Hashim has commiserated with the federal government and other people of Benue State on the killings within the State which he stated appear to have defied logic and options.
It was reported that not less than 100 folks have been killed in an assault by gunmen in a village within the State, in keeping with Amnesty Worldwide Nigeria.
The assault happened from late Friday into the early hours of Saturday within the village of Yelwata.
